US Defense Department Backs The Better Meat Co. with $1.4M for Advanced Biotech Development
Vegconomist • Aug 26, 2024
The Better Meat Co. has been awarded a $1.4 million grant from the United States Department of Defense as part of the Distributed Bioindustrial Manufacturing Program. The funding will support the production of its mycoprotein ingredient, Rhiza, which is used as a sustainable protein alternative. The company recently received FDA recognition for the safety of Rhiza, and plans to scale up production with the grant.
The investments from the DoD aim to strengthen the United States' bioeconomic capabilities and enhance defense capabilities. The company's innovative biotech development is seen as a way to make supply chains more resilient, create jobs, and strengthen America's economy. This funding will support the company in reaching cost parity with commodity beef and increasing domestic biomanufacturing capabilities.
